- Liver plays a role in PAH pathogenesis via inflammatory injury to pulmonary endothelium.
- PAH patients with MELD-Na ≥ 12 have higher pulmonary vascular resistance and reduced exercise capacity.
- IL-6 is identified as a key hub in inflammatory pathways linking liver dysfunction to PAH.
- Liver fibrosis trends are observed in PAH patients and models, supporting a lung-liver axis.
- Subclinical liver dysfunction clusters are associated with worse clinical outcomes in PAH.
